Gifts and talents Quote by George R. R. Martin
““The gods give each of us our little gifts and talents, and it is meant for us to use them, my aunt always says. Any act can be a prayer, if done as well as we are able.””
About This Quote
Source Book: A Game of Thrones, George R. R. Martin, 1996
Each person possesses unique gifts meant to be used for good, turning ordinary actions into acts of devotion.
In simple terms: Use your talents as prayers.
